Out-of-school rate for children of primary school age, adjusted in Sierra Leone
Sierra Leone: Out-of-school rate for children of primary school age, adjusted was 0.679 GPIA in 2019. ▼ Falling
Out-of-school rate for children of primary school age, adjusted in Sierra Leone, 2008–2019
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in GPIA.
Analysis
The most recent figure for out-of-school rate for children of primary school age, adjusted in Sierra Leone is 0.679 GPIA, measured in 2019. That is the lowest value across all 5 years on record.
The figure is down 8.8% on the previous year and down 32.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, out-of-school rate for children of primary school age, adjusted in Sierra Leone peaked at 1.01 GPIA in 2008 and was at its lowest, 0.679 GPIA, in 2019.
Sierra Leone ranks 43rd of 52 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
Out-of-school rate for children of primary school age, adjusted in Sierra Leone, year by year
| Year | GPIA |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2008 | 1.01 GPIA | — |
| 2010 | 0.8999 GPIA | -11.1% |
| 2013 | 0.8475 GPIA | -5.8% |
| 2017 | 0.7445 GPIA | -12.1% |
| 2019 | 0.679 GPIA | -8.8% |
